Gone Home is a first-person exploratory puzzle game set inPlayers assume the role of Katie, a university student returning to her family's new mansion after a trip to Europe, only to find it deserted. The game revolves around uncovering the mysteries of her family's past, driven by the note left by her younger sister, Sam, who has seemingly left home. As players navigate the intricately designed mansion, they will encounter various items, notes, and environmental clues that reveal the family's history and the reasons behind Sam's departure.
The gameplay emphasizes exploration and narrative over traditional puzzles, allowing players to piece together the story at their own pace. The atmospheric setting and detailed environments create an immersive experience, encouraging players to engage with the narrative deeply. Gone Home's unique approach to storytelling and emotional depth sets it apart in the puzzle game genre, making it a memorable experience for those who enjoy narrative-driven gameplay.
